# TRSL/TRF Governance
Status: Draft v0.1
Date: 2026-07-29
Workplan: `workplans/TREV-WP-0008-governance-and-pilot-rollout.md` T01
Primary artifacts: `specs/TargetRevenueLicenseConcept.md` §20, `specs/MonetizationExtensionSpecification.md` §4, `specs/CanonicalizationReviewChecklist.md`, `docs/adr/ADR-0002-hosted-trust-service-stack.md`
Implements concept §20's four governance principles (complexity budget,
versioning, extension governance, operator governance) as concrete,
operative rules for this framework's actual current state — a single
hosted Trust Service instance, one resolved Licensor, and four candidate
product lines — rather than restating §20 in the abstract.

## 1. Licensor identity — resolved
**Decision (maintainer, 2026-07-29):** there is a single Licensor across
all Phases declared under this framework for the foreseeable future:
**Binky Hedgehog GmbH**, operating as the **`binky` tenant** in the
`licensors` table (`migrations/0001_registries.sql`) and across the
`coulomb` Forgejo org's product lines (`coulomb-loop`, `net-kingdom`,
`helix-forge`, the `railiance-*` family).
**Consequences of this choice, made explicit rather than left implicit:**
- One Licensor API token (or a small, rotatable set under the same
`licensor_id`) covers all four product lines' Phase registrations and
Ledger appends — there is no per-product-line Licensor isolation at the
Trust Service level; isolation between *Phases* (`TS-FR-8`) still holds,
but not between *product lines*, since they share one Licensor identity.
- Commercial and legal exposure across all four product lines' Phases
nominally attaches to the same legal entity. A dispute, breach
determination (`specs/TargetRevenueSourceLicense-V1C1.md` §7.4), or
Enforcement Action (`specs/EnforcementNetworkConcept.md`) on one
product line's Phase does not legally implicate the others, but it is
the same counterparty's record across all of them — a reputational and
administrative fact worth naming, not a legal one this document
resolves.
- **Now unblocked, not yet decided:** knowing the Licensor entity's own
jurisdiction (Germany, GmbH) is exactly the missing input
`history/260729-TRSL-Jurisdiction-Synthesis.md` §2 flagged before the
arbitral institution and substantive governing law in License §11.1 /
CUA §18 could be filled in from a template blank to an actual value.
This document does not make that selection — it is a distinct, focused
decision for whoever owns the License/CUA templates next, now that the
blocking unknown (Licensor identity) is resolved.
- If this decision changes later (e.g., a product line spins out under
its own entity), each Phase already declared under `binky` remains
governed by `binky` as its Licensor of record — Phase Manifests are
immutable (TSD §3.1), so a Licensor change is prospective only, never
retroactive.
## 2. Complexity budget (concept §20.1)
Applied as-is: a proposed addition to the normative core
(`specs/TargetRevenueFrameworkCore.md`, `specs/PhaseManifestSpecification.md`,
`specs/TargetLedgerSpecification.md`, `specs/MonetizationExtensionSpecification.md`)
must pass all three tests — universal, interoperable, trust-critical — or
it belongs in a canonical profile
(`specs/CanonicalMonetizationProfiles.md`), a degeneration policy
(`specs/TargetDegenerationPolicyResearch.md`), an implementation detail
(`docs/adr/`), or a project-specific policy (a single Phase's own Manifest
fields), never the shared core. This is not new policy — WP-0003's own
review process already applied it (e.g., the §1.11 fix rejecting a
broadened core-term-redefinition list) — this section names it as a
standing rule rather than an ad hoc practice.
## 3. Versioning (concept §20.2)
Already implemented, not merely planned, across every layer §20.2 names:
| Layer | Versioning mechanism | Where |
|---|---|---|
| TRSL legal text | `Version 1, Candidate <n>` in the document header | `specs/TargetRevenueSourceLicense-V1C1.md` |
| Framework core | Dated normative extracts, sourced from the concept doc | `specs/TargetRevenueFrameworkCore.md` et al. |
| Phase Manifest schema | `framework`/`license` semver-like tags in the manifest itself | `schemas/phase_manifest.schema.json` |
| Degeneration policies | `trsl:policy:<slug>@<version>` URN | e.g. `trsl:policy:linear-longstop-v0@1.0` |
| Monetization extensions | `trsl:extension:<slug>@<version>` URN | `schemas/extension_contract.schema.json` |
| Trust Service protocol | This repository's own commit history + `docs/adr/` decisions | `docs/adr/ADR-0001`, `ADR-0002` |
**Rule, stated explicitly for the first time here:** a Phase remains
governed by the exact versions it declared at registration
(`phase.framework`, `phase.license`, `phase.degeneration_policy`,
`phase.extensions[]`) unless an explicit, recorded migration is accepted
for that specific Phase — never a silent, framework-wide reinterpretation
that changes an already-registered Phase's terms out from under it.
## 4. Extension governance (concept §20.3)
| §20.3 item | Status |
|---|---|
| Registration criteria | `specs/MonetizationExtensionSpecification.md` §3 (conformance rule) + `src/target_revenue/validation.py` — implemented and tested |
| Canonicalization criteria | `specs/CanonicalizationReviewChecklist.md` (WP-0007-T04) — implemented as a checklist, not yet exercised against any real profile |
| Conformance tests | `tests/test_extension_conformance.py`, `tests/test_hosted_conformance.py` — implemented |
| Compatibility rules | **Not yet defined.** No document yet states what happens when a `canonical` extension's own contract needs a breaking change (new major version vs. deprecate-and-replace). Flagged as an open item, §6 below. |
| Deprecation rules | **Partially defined.** `status: deprecated` exists in the schema and is described in §4 of the extension spec ("no longer recommended; existing registrations remain valid evidence") but no document describes *who* may deprecate an extension or under what criteria — same gap pattern as canonicalization had before WP-0007-T04. Flagged, §6. |
| Conflict-of-interest rules | **Not yet defined.** With a single Licensor (§1) reviewing its own extensions for canonicalization, the reviewer and the reviewed party's interests are not separated by default. Flagged, §6. |
| Dispute procedures | Partially covered by `specs/TargetRevenueSourceLicense-V1C1.md` §7 (breach/cure/termination) and `specs/TargetRevenueCommercialUseAgreement-V1C1.md` §9 (breach disclosure), but no procedure exists yet for a dispute *about an extension's canonicalization or deprecation* specifically, as distinct from a dispute about a Phase's own Commercial Use. Flagged, §6. |
## 5. Operator governance (concept §20.4)
For the single hosted Trust Service instance
(`workplans/TREV-WP-0006-trust-service-implementation.md`, deployed per
`docs/adr/ADR-0002-hosted-trust-service-stack.md` on `railiance-cluster`):
| §20.4 disclosure | Current answer |
|---|---|
| Operator identity | Binky Hedgehog GmbH (`binky` tenant) — same entity as the Licensor (§1); this framework does not currently distinguish "who operates the Trust Service" from "who is the Licensor," since both are the same party at this stage |
| Applicable terms | This repository's specs (`specs/TargetRevenueLicenseConcept.md` and its extracts) govern the framework; no separate Trust-Service-specific terms of service exist yet — flagged, §6 |
| Signing keys | `TRF_SIGNING_KEY_HEX` env var, Ed25519, exposed publicly and unauthenticated via `GET /public-key` (`service/app.py`) so any party can verify a signature independent of trusting the operator's access control (`docs/adr/ADR-0002-hosted-trust-service-stack.md`) |
| Key-rotation history | **Not yet tracked.** No mechanism exists yet to publish a history of past signing keys if the current one is ever rotated — a verifier who only has the current public key cannot verify historical entries signed under a prior key. Flagged, §6. |
| Service continuity policy | Single-instance, single-server (ADR-0002's explicitly named risk: "single HostEurope server is a single point of failure... acceptable for alpha/beta pilot scale... must be revisited before any external or higher-availability commitment") |
| Archival and export policy | Every Phase's full evidence package (Manifest, Ledger, Attestation) is exportable via public `GET` endpoints at any time (`specs/TrustServiceProductRequirementsDocument.md` §6) — no separate scheduled-archival process exists beyond "export is always available," which is adequate for offline verifiability (TSD §5) but not a substitute for an operator-side backup/disaster-recovery policy, which is an infrastructure concern for `railiance-cluster`, not this repository |
| Correction and dispute processes | Ledger corrections: `credit-reversal`/`remission-correction`/`administrative-correction-*` entry types (append-only, TSD §3.2). Broader disputes: License §7 / CUA §9. No Trust-Service-specific "I think this record is wrong" process beyond those ledger-level correction types exists yet |
| Framework change process | This repository's own workplan/ADR/human-accept-gate process (`CONTRIBUTING.md`), which is itself the framework change process — there is no separate, more formal process distinct from how this repository already operates |
## 6. Explicitly open items (not resolved by this document)
Naming these here — rather than letting them stay implicit — is this
document's actual contribution beyond restating what already exists:
1. **Extension compatibility/deprecation criteria** (§4): who may deprecate
a canonical extension, and what counts as a breaking vs. non-breaking
change to one.
2. **Conflict-of-interest rule for canonicalization** (§4): with one
Licensor currently reviewing its own extensions, some explicit
acknowledgment or safeguard is warranted before canonicalization
becomes routine — even if the safeguard is initially as simple as
"canonicalization decisions are recorded publicly with named
attribution" (already true per `CanonicalizationReviewChecklist.md`
item 8) rather than a heavier external-review requirement.
3. **Extension/canonicalization-specific dispute procedure**, distinct
from the License/CUA's Commercial-Use-focused dispute provisions.
4. **Signing-key rotation history publication** (§5): no mechanism yet for
a verifier to check a signature made under a since-rotated key.
5. **A Trust-Service-specific terms-of-service document**, separate from
the framework specs themselves.
None of these block `workplans/TREV-WP-0008-governance-and-pilot-rollout.md`
T02T04 (repo survey, draft pilot manifests, CLA draft) — they are named
so that T05's go-live gate can weigh them explicitly rather than discover
them as an afterthought once real Phases are already running.
